Miter Saw Mastery: Cutting Aluminium with Precision
Achieving perfect cuts of the metal with your power saw demands particular techniques. Unlike wood, aluminium tends to gum to the teeth, potentially causing a uneven edge and binding. To circumvent this, consistently use a high-tooth blade intended for non-ferrous metals . Reducing the cutting speed – that's how rapidly you push the material into the blade – is critical ; a deliberate approach yields far better results. In addition, cooling the blade with a oil can lessen gumming and improve the final cut quality .
Picking the Correct Miter Tool for Alloy Projects
When working with metal projects, selecting the correct miter tool is essential . Standard miter devices can tear and damage the soft material, leading to rough cuts and unusable pieces. Look for a more info tool with a fine-tooth blade specifically made for soft metals, or consider a cold-cutting miter tool which eliminates heat buildup and lessens the chance of bending . The feature to modify blade revolutions is also helpful for achieving clean, accurate cuts.
